best enduro pedal out...

I have been on the CB enduros for several years and the E 11 specifically for around 2 years. The customization for fit and feel of the E pedals is unmatched and the fact that they are completely rebuildable is a cherry on top. I did swap out the spindle for the longer version and am running the easy release cleat...as my knees seem to do better with the extra stance width and ease of exit. I have two summers of heavy park riding and countless trail days on this set, they have held up very well and are just starting to get a tiny bit of play in the bearings...refresh kit is easy to install.

Mallet Me More

These pedals are awesome. Good platform, light (which you pay for) and the egg beater mech seems good. I like having the combination of a platform and clipless: get some of the efficiency of clipless while having a bit more stability of a flat. I primarily ride buffed out single track in PC, UT as fast as I can without ever racing except STRAVA racing. I travel some to the desert and bike more technical stuff and not having a straight clipless pedal is nice in more technical stuff that I am less adept at.

The platforms of the mallet provide a nice stability during rides, especially on techy portions. Given that it has more surface area you should expect more peddle strikes but generally the shoes won’t release as they would with smaller platforms like the (also fantastic) egg beaters.
